3D printing people! There is a Fediverse platform just for you which lets you upload and share 3D print models:

➡️ https://manyfold.app

You can follow the official account at:

➡️ @manyfold

There's a public server you can join at:

➡️ https://3dprint.social (Click "Sign In" and then "Create Account" to sign up)

If you just want to try it, there's a demo server at:

➡️ https://try.manyfold.app

p.s. Because it's federated through the Fediverse, you can follow Manyfold accounts from other Manyfold servers and also from Mastodon etc accounts.

Manyfold is free open source software, and if you're techy you can self-host it using the instructions at https://manyfold.app/get-started/installation

@FediTips @manyfold Wait, how does the federation part work? Are Manyfold accounts able to follow Mastodon accounts from their end?
@Nyla_Smokeyface technically you *can*, though it will warn you that probably nothing interesting will happen. Followers on Mastodon etc will see messages for new models and comments, but the following from within Manyfold is really aimed at subscribing to content on other Manyfold instances (or anything else that wants to use our ActivityPub extension for 3d models).
